Beyond reshaping the OTT landscape, Applause Entertainment has carved a niche for nurturing fresh talent, turning them into the next big thing in the industry. Their commitment to craft over celebrity status has consistently brought critical and commercial hits, reshaping the careers of many budding actors by offering platforms that highlight their unique abilities.

Under the leadership of MD Sameer Nair, Applause stands out for its bold casting choices—choosing actors who may not have a famous lineage but possess the skill and passion to bring characters to life. This keen eye for talent and willingness to bet on newcomers has set new standards in how actors establish themselves, especially in the ever-expanding OTT space.

Take Black Warrant as an example—a gripping series that introduced audiences to new faces and unexpected performances. Anurag Thakur made a remarkable debut as Dhakkad Dahiya, captivating viewers with his authentic Haryanvi accent and raw energy. Zahan Kapoor also shone as Sunil Gupta, a rookie officer navigating the complexities of Tihar Jail, delivering a performance that revealed his depth and dedication to the role.

For Sidhant Gupta, Black Warrant was a game-changer, with his chilling portrayal of Charles Sobhraj leaving a lasting impression. His intense and nuanced depiction of the infamous serial killer earned him widespread praise and demonstrated his versatility as an actor.

Applause’s success with casting extends beyond Black Warrant. Pratik Gandhi’s breakout role as Harshad Mehta in Scam 1992 remains a testament to Applause’s knack for spotting talent. His transformation from a respected regional actor to a national sensation showcased his remarkable range. Similarly, Gagan Dev Riar’s portrayal of Abdul Karim Telgi in Scam 2003 brought to life the complexities of the character with authenticity, earning him critical acclaim. Surya Sharma, with his powerful performance as Rinku in Undekhi, further exemplified Applause’s ability to unearth actors who can dive into morally complex roles.

Applause Entertainment continues to champion new talent, proving that it’s not about star power but about finding and supporting artists who bring depth, authenticity, and innovation to the screen. With each project, Applause not only tells compelling stories but also helps actors make their mark in the entertainment world.
